If only it stopped there. Paul isn't a traditional conservative. His obsession with long-decided monetary policy and isolationism are not his only half-baked crusades. Paul's newsletters of the '80s and '90s were filled with anti-Semitic and racist rants, proving his slumming in the ugliest corners of conspiracyland today is no mistake.
You can't take this article seriously with the slanderous remarks above. The author must see the future of Conservatism to be NeoConservatism. If Paul isn't a Traditional Conservative, I'd like know who he considers to fall under this category. It wasn't long ago that we all supported Bush in 2000 when he ran on a non-interventionist policy. It's strange how the author wrote a book on the "Nanny State" and recognizes many of the problems we have today, but seems to throw his support behind establishment candidates that were at the watch while all this happened.
Does anyone remember the debate when the moderator went down the line and every Republican candidate stated that the economy was on the uptick until Paul answered?
If we keep throwing are support behind the same candidates, we're doomed to have the same results.
